1 Identify the Need for a RESETTING PATH
First, ask yourself: What part of my life feels misaligned? Whether it’s a career that no longer sparks joy, a relationship that’s draining, or a habit that’s become a rut, the RESETTING PATH mindset encourages you to redirect your course. Think of it as a GPS recalculating after you miss a turn. The key steps are:
1. Name the area that needs change. 2. Visualize the desired destination – not just a vague hope, but a concrete picture. 3. Commit to a new direction – write a one‑sentence mission statement.
Homework: Write down the three most pressing areas where you feel you need a RESETTING PATH. Keep this list visible on your desk.

2 Apply PRACTICAL WISDOM to the New Route
Now that you have a fresh direction, sprinkle it with PRACTICAL WISDOM. This isn’t abstract philosophy; it’s the common‑sense judgment you use when you decide whether to take the highway or the scenic route. Ask yourself:
What’s the simplest, most effective step I can take today? - Where might I need to compromise to keep momentum?
When you pair PRACTICAL WISDOM with RESETTING PATH, you avoid the trap of grandiose plans that never materialize. Instead, you create real‑world actions that feel doable and sustainable.
Tip: Use the “Three‑Minute Rule.” If a task can be started in three minutes, do it now. This tiny act of sound judgment builds momentum.
3 The Reset‑Wise Cycle: A Practical Framework
Below is a step‑by‑step cycle that you can repeat weekly. Each loop reinforces the other concept, turning a one‑time reset into a lifelong habit.
| Phase | What You Do | How RESETTING PATH Helps | How PRACTICAL WISDOM Guides | | | | | | | Reflect | Review last week’s outcomes. | Spot misalignments; decide if a course correction is needed. | Ask, “What worked, what didn’t, and why?” | | Re‑Set | Choose a new micro‑goal. | Realign with your larger vision. | Choose the goal that requires the least friction to start. | | Act | Execute the micro‑goal. | Build confidence through small wins. | Apply common‑sense shortcuts (e.g., batch similar tasks). | | Assess | Measure results. | Determine if the new path is still viable. | Adjust based on realistic feedback, not ego. |
Practice: Run through this table for one area of your life this week. Record your observations in a journal.
4 Storytelling Spotlight: Maya’s Career Pivot
Maya was a senior analyst who felt her RESETTING PATH was blocked by a stagnant role. She imagined a career in graphic design but feared the unknown. By invoking PRACTICAL WISDOM, she:
Mapped a realistic timeline: 2 evenings a week for online courses. - Negotiated a part‑time freelance gig to test waters without quitting her day job. - Compromised on salary expectations initially, focusing on skill acquisition.
Six months later, Maya launched a boutique design studio. Her story illustrates how RESETTING PATH provides the why and PRACTICAL WISDOM supplies the how.
5 Your Personal Action Plan (The 7‑Day Reset‑Wise Sprint)
1. Day 1 – Vision Mapping: Write a 2‑sentence new direction statement. (Resetting Path) 2. Day 2 – Wisdom Audit: List three everyday decisions where you can apply sound judgment. (Practical Wisdom) 3. Day 3 – Micro‑Goal Setting: Choose one tiny action that aligns with your new direction. (Both) 4. Day 4 – Execution: Perform the micro‑goal using the Three‑Minute Rule. (Practical Wisdom) 5. Day 5 – Reflection: Journal what felt easy vs. what felt resistant. (Resetting Path) 6. Day 6 – Adjustment: Tweak the goal or approach based on your reflection. (Both) 7. Day 7 – Celebration: Acknowledge the progress, no matter how small. Reward yourself with something you love.
